The flows offered by the various Internet suppliers vary according to where you live : all cities are not covered in the same way by Internet operators. For example, you may not be eligible for optical fiber in some suppliers.
There are several ways to test his eligibility fiber or ADSL, to determine the best internet offers available at your address.
- You can contact a Selectra advisor to find the internet offer most suited to your home.
- The websites of the various suppliers make it possible to pass eligibility tests: your postal address and the name of the former owner or tenant will be requested.
- In store, you can meet advisers from different operators to ask all your questions and test your internet eligibility.
In the three cases, you will be directly informed of the best offers to which your accommodation can claim.

It is rare to benefit from the flow indicated by operators: it is the maximum speed permitted by the offer that is presented. Real flow will depend on where your lives and possible interference on the line: you can do a speed test to measure it. The best internet supplier can therefore change according to your address.

When you subscribe to an offer with engagement, you must comply with this commitment period, generally one year. If you decide to stop the subscription after a few months, you will then have to pay Termination Fee Depending on the remaining duration of the contract.
You want to take advantage of an internet subscription without having to commit yourself over a year or more ? Some operators offer non -binding offers, Resiliable at any time. RED benefits from SFR infrastructure, while SOSH is an orange brand, using the operator’s internet network.
THE cheapest non -binding package is offered by RED: you benefit from a rate of 500 Mb/s at the price of € 19.99/month, Terminable at any time. The price is € 24.99 if you take a TV option (100 channels). The Freebox Pop is the most complete non -binding offer, including a TV bouquet of more than 270 channels. The best internet operator according to your address
Find the best fixed internet operator at home is possible using the interactive card of Arcep (Electronic communications regulatory authority). This card has the advantage of being very practical if you want to know What Internet technology is accessible to your address And what are the flows displayed by the various suppliers according to your location. All this information is available via the Arcep website “My internet connection”, that allows you to Test your internet eligibility. The map not only covers metropolitan France, but also overseas areas. Whether you live in metropolitan area or in ultra-marine territories, you can see the operators who have deployed a network at home, but also to what internet offers you are eligible.
here are the 2 steps to follow To find out how to use the arcep card once you are on the “my internet connection” site:
- Enter the Name of your municipality in the search field which appears at the top left of your screen.
- You see a list of operators appear by Internet technology (Optical fiber, ADSL/VDSL, 4G, satellite) which are currently available at home. That’s not all: minimum and maximum theoretical flow rates in reception and emission provided by each of these operators are specified.
This detailed overview allows you to quickly visualize which internet access provider (FAI) is the best for you according to your address.
In summary, the interactive card Provision to individuals by ARCEP is a very efficient online tool which gives you updated information on the Availability of Internet operators. The goal is that you can have a visual representation of the Geographic coverage of FAI In the different regions of France. All you have to do is make the most judicious choice according to your address, that is to say by choosing the Internet operator who covers your town while having any performance that best meets your expectations.
Good to know: if you already know that you want to have the fiber at home, the arcep has developed a Card dedicated to optical fiber. This specific cartography tool The deployment of FTTH fiber (fiber to the home) in France. To have the instantaneous answer, it is enough again to type your address and there are then three possibilities: your municipality is indicated either as deployed (and therefore connectable to fiber), or as in deployment or connectable on request, either in deployment or studying planning.

What internet technology in my city ?
There are several types of Internet access technologies in France. These are :
- There optical fiber. The most widespread technology, it offers internet access with the highest flows. The government’s very high speed plan provides for the “all fiber” by 2030.
- L’ADSL. Deployed in most cities where fiber has not yet been deployed, ADSL allows decent internet connection.
- THE 4G and 5G box. They are a substitution solution for households whose ADSL flow is too low and whose 4G network coverage is correct.
- THE satellite. If you live in a white area where fiber and ADSL technologies are not accessible, satellite internet boxes are the best option to consider.

Which internet supplier has the best speed ?
According to the last barometer nperf achieved in early July 2023 which published the results of debit tests Made for each operator, The average flow is 297 Mbit/s In France. Since optical fiber is technology with the highest flows, we can compare operators’ performance by focusing on this technology. Free is by far the operator having the most powerful average descending flow with 590 Mbit/s. Which internet operator has the most reliable network ?
As a historic operator, formerly France Telecom, Orange is not surprised at first row of the classification of operators with the best quality of internet network, particularly in terms of infrastructure and deployment of it in the territory. To capture the greatest number of future subscribers and get to the orange level, the other operators have gradually invested in their own infrastructure. Behind Orange, the other holes renowned for reliability are, in order, Free, Bouygues and SFR.
A good indicator that makes it possible to judge the reliability of the internet network of an operator is the Number of breakdowns detected year -round. According to the ZoneAdsl site, which lists breakdowns and incidents that French subscribers to the various Internet operators go up each year, The back of the medal in 2022 is for free, who comes at the top of the breakdowns with breakdowns with 36% of reports. SFR Don’t really do better by counting 34% of breakdowns, followed by Bouygues, penultimate with 18%, And Orange which denotes with “only” 11% of internet breakdowns.
Customer satisfaction: which internet supplier stands out ?
ARCEP regularly publishes surveys on customer satisfaction with the quality of the service rendered by Internet operators. The 2023 edition of the Annual Customer satisfaction observatory of ARCEP has given its verdict: Orange and Free are the two best Internet operators according to the criterion of customer satisfaction, followed by Bouygues and SFR. Respondents had to benefit from an internet connection at home to participate in the survey. The purpose of the latter was therefore to assess What the level of customer satisfaction with their FAI.
FAI classification based on customer ratings Compared to the quality of service and technical support:

- Orange(note of 7.9/10)
- Free (note of 7.8/10)
- Bouygues (note of 7.4/10)
- SFR(note of 7.0/01)
THE Customer dissatisfaction reasons The most recurrent with regard to the quality of the fixed internet are: an instability of the internet connection, poor reception of the TV and the problems encountered with fixed telephony.
